چکیده مقاله:
Introduction: Hiccup is the sudden onset of erratic diaphragmatic and intercostal muscle contraction and immediately followed by laryngeal closure. Acute hiccup is a minor complication that can occur during sedation or general anaesthesia. The objective was to perform a systematic search for treating hiccup occurring with LMA insertion.
Method: A systematic search for reports describing interventions to treat hiccup during anesthesia was carried out (MEDLINE, EMBASE, Cochrane-Library, manual screening of reference lists and review articles, up to ۲۰۲۲). Search terms were anesthesia, LMA , hiccup
Result: After search and analysis, finally ۷ full text articles selected. based on studies A rapid phasic distension of the proximal esophagus can cause hiccups in normal subjects, but a slow ramp distension or distal esophagus does not cause hiccups. Therefore, a sudden rapid stretch of the mechanoreceptors in the pharynx might trigger the hiccup reflex. If this is true, atropine should be effective in relieving a vagal reflex. Indeed, cervical epidural block for blocking the vagus and/or the phrenic nerve is effective in postoperative intractable hiccups. Studies show two possible mechanisms of action for the suppression of hiccups by atropine. First, atropine could act directly on the esophagus by means of decreasing intraesophageal pressure. Second, atropine may act indirectly on the central nervous system via enhancement of sympathetic nerve activity.
Conclusion: In conclusion, in a case of severe hiccups after LMA insertion and not responding to conventional methods of treatment, administration of IV atropine can prove beneficial. Although further clinical investigation is needed to be sure more.
